Sep 3, 2021 · There are at least three women in the history of female saints with the name Petka: St Petka (X-XI century) originating from the region of Trace, St Paraskeva the Great-Martyr (136-161) who preached to laics in Rome, and the Holy Great-Martyr Paraskeva of Ikonium (303) from Middle Asia beheaded for her faith in Christ during Diocletian' rule. The day of her death, October 14, is the Feastday of several Bulgarian towns (Tvarditsa, Nova Zagora and Apriltsi). Oct 14, 2020 · Saint Paraskeva (Saint Petka of Bulgaria) is held in high esteem by Orthodox Christians in this country, with churches named after her all over Bulgaria. Aug 31, 2022 · The name Saint Friday has strong pre-Christian connotations, and the distinction between Saint Friday of Tarnovo and Saint Friday of Russia, or other such “saints” found in the rich traditions of Russia and the Balkans, is still a subject of controversy among specialists.
